| With a WLAN (Wireless Local Area Network) access point you can build your own wireless network and share network resources like printers and storage space. You can even share one internet connection with your entire wireless local area network by connecting your access point (by Ethernet) to your (A)DSL or cable modem with built in router/DHCP server! |

PoE Support Enclosed in a plenum metal chassis, the DWL-3200AP adheres to strict fire codes and ensures complete safety. For advanced installations, this high- speed access point has an integrated 802.3af Power over Ethernet (PoE) support to allow installation in areas where power outlets are not readily available.
Up to 108Mbps Wireless Speed The DWL-3200AP delivers extremely reliable wireless performance with standard 802.11g wireless throughput rates of up to 54Mbps. It has the added capability of reaching maximum wireless signal rates of up to 108Mbps (Turbo mode) powered by D-Link 108G technology. At the same time, the DWL- 3200AP remains fully compatible with the IEEE 802.11b and 802.11g standards.
Advanced Wireless Security Since wireless security remains a strong concern among businesses, the DWL-3200AP provides the latest wireless security technologies by supporting both WPAEnterprise and 802.1x to ensure complete network protection. In addition, the DWL-3200AP currently comes 802.11i-ready to fully support industrial grade wireless security.
Advanced Network Management Network administrators can manage all the DWL-3200AP's settings via its web-based configuration utility or with Telnet. For advanced network management, the administrators can use D-Link's AP Manager or D-View SNMP management module to configure and manage multiple access points from a single location. In addition to a streamlined management process, network administrators can also verify and conduct regular maintenance checks without wasting resources by sending personnel out to physically verify proper operation.
WDS (Wireless Distribution System) Support To maximize total return on investment, the DWL-3200AP can be configured to operate as an access point (AP mode), a point-to-point bridge or a point-to-multipoint bridge (WDS mode). In the WDS mode, the DWL-3200AP communicates only with wireless bridges, without allowing for wireless clients or stations to access them.
Increased Network Flexibility and Efficiency The DWL-3200AP supports multiple SSIDs, allowing you to separate applications based on security and performance requirements. You can enable encryption and authentication on one SSID to protect private applications and no security on another SSID to maximize open connectivity for public usage. Multiple SSIDs means you can mix and match the broadcasting of SSIDs. For public Internet access applications, you can broadcast the SSID to enable user radio cards to automatically find available access points. For private applications, you can disable SSID broadcast to prevent intruders from identifying your network. You can set the number of users that can associate via a particular SSID to control usage of particular applications. This can help provide a somewhat limited form of bandwidth control for particular applications.
Cost Saving and Mobile Applications By supporting multiple SSIDs, the DWL-3200AP allows you to logically divide your access point into several virtual access points all within a single hardware platform. Rather than having two separate WLANs, you can deploy one access point to support more than one application, such as public Internet access and internal network control to increase flexibility and keep costs down.
